The Service and Repair Coordinator supports efficient operations of The Modal Shop's technical service department by managing administrative and logistical aspects of service and repair activities. The role plays an integral part in the end-to-end process of service orders, from quotation generation to documentation and post-service communication. Collaboration across internal teams—including Production, Engineering, Sales, and Order Fulfillment—is essential to success in this position.
Additional duties include:
- Prepare and maintain service and repair quotations using TMS CRM tools; manage follow-ups and activity status within system guidelines.
- Record and document all relevant service information accurately in the TMS CRM system.
- Coordinate service activities and act as liaison between technical departments to ensure timely execution of service and repair jobs.
- Track incoming requests related to quotations, and route technical queries to subject matter experts when escalation is necessary.
- Organize and deliver required technical and safety documentation associated with each service order.
- Monitor and provide updates on the progress of service orders, including coordinating with the internal logistics team to manage outbound communication and return shipments.
- Execute contract reviews following defined internal procedures to ensure customer and compliance standards are met.
- Assess and prioritize incoming returns; initiate operational checks and repair paperwork prior to routing hardware to product groups or sales teams.
- Investigate service-related issues, propose corrective actions, and compile internal reports for quality improvement and management review.
- Perform other duties and operational needs to contribute to the overall efficiency of The Modal Shop's Service team.
